Description

1 3-Di-tert-Butylimidazolium Tetrafluoro is a high-purity, specialty ionic liquid salt characterized by its unique sterically hindered imidazolium cation. This compound is valued for its role as a precursor or catalyst component in advanced organic synthesis and materials science, offering enhanced stability and tunable properties. It is primarily sought by researchers and manufacturers in the pharmaceutical, agrochemical, and specialty polymer industries for developing novel reaction pathways and functional materials.

Application

  • As a precursor for N-heterocyclic carbene (NHC) ligands in transition metal catalysis.
  • As a catalyst or co-catalyst in organic transformations such as cross-coupling, polymerization, and C-H activation reactions.
  • In the synthesis of ionic liquids with tailored physical and chemical properties for electrochemical applications.
  • As a stabilizing agent or additive in advanced material formulations, including polymers and composites.
  • For academic and industrial R&D in exploring new catalytic systems and reaction mechanisms.
  • In the development of pharmaceutical intermediates where specific steric and electronic environments are required.

Basic Information

Product Name 1 3-Di-tert-Butylimidazolium Tetrafluoro
CAS No. 263163-17-3
Molecular Formula C14H26F4N2
Molecular Weight 298.37 g/mol
Synonyms 1,3-Di-tert-butylimidazolium tetrafluoroborate; 1,3-Di-tert-butyl-1H-imidazol-3-ium tetrafluoroborate; 1,3-Bis(1,1-dimethylethyl)imidazolium tetrafluoroborate; 1,3-Di-tert-butylimidazolium BF4; DTBIM BF4; 1,3-DTBI BF4; 1,3-Di-t-butylimidazolium tetrafluoroborate

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ated place at room temperature (15-25°C). Due to its hygroscopic (moisture-sensitive) nature, the container must be kept tightly sealed under an inert atmosphere (e.g., nitrogen or argon) after opening to prevent degradation.
